Qala Shallows DFS update lifts revenue forecast 58%

Qala Shallows DFS update lifts revenue forecast 58%

West Wits Mining chairman Michael Quinert talked with Proactive about the updated Definitive Feasibility Study (DFS) for the Qala Shallows project, part of the Witwatersrand Basin Project (WBP) in South Africa.

The revised DFS shows a 58% increase in forecast revenue, now sitting at $2.7 billion, driven primarily by a significant rise in the gold price and a lower cut-off grade allowing for greater mineable material. Quinert explained that the gold price assumption in the study was increased from $1,850 to $2,850 per ounce—still conservative given today’s spot price of around $3,400.

“This is being done at a long-term consensus forecast of US$2,850 an ounce… so there’s still a lot of upside,” Quinert noted. He added that a higher gold price has also extended the peak production phase from nine to twelve years.

The company also reports that free cash flow is now expected to rise by $461 million, reaching $983 million under the new assumptions. While costs have increased slightly, now estimated at $1,288 per ounce, the margin has been substantially enhanced due to the higher gold price. Quinert emphasized the reliability of the updated figures, saying, “They’re all based on actual contracted numbers or most of them are now.”

Operational progress is already underway. West Wits has mobilized contractors and equipment to site, including a load-haul-dump unit, signalling a move toward full production in the near term.
